How much do snow plow drivers j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for snow plow drivers in the United States is $24.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.47 and $28.85 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Snow Plow Drivers and Salt Spreaders both operate in winter road maintenance, often working together. Snow Plow Drivers focus on clearing snow using plow blades, while Salt Spreaders distribute salt or de-icing materials to prevent ice formation. Both roles require similar credentials and work environments, making them closely related in the winter road maintenance industry.

Do snow plow drivers make good money?

Snow plow drivers typically earn an hourly wage that can range from minimum wage to higher rates depending on experience, location, and employer. Many drivers receive additional pay for overtime, night shifts, or during severe weather conditions, making it a potentially well-paying seasonal job for those with the necessary skills and certifications. Overall, earnings vary but can be competitive within winter maintenance roles.

How to get a job as a snow plow driver?

To become a snow plow driver, you typically need a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and sometimes a commercial driver's license (CDL) depending on the vehicle size. Experience with operating heavy equipment and knowledge of winter road conditions are also beneficial. Applying to local government agencies, private snow removal companies, or transportation departments is common for job opportunities.

Is it hard to be a snow plow driver?

Being a snow plow driver involves operating large equipment in winter conditions, often requiring physical stamina, attention to safety, and sometimes specialized training or certifications. The job can be physically demanding and requires working early mornings, nights, or during storms, but it is generally straightforward for those with proper training and experience.
